How Much Protein is in One Jamaican Beef Patty?

5 min read
Nutritional data indicates that the protein amount in a single Jamaican beef patty can fluctuate greatly, ranging from 8 to 17 grams depending on the brand, size, and recipe. This variance is primarily due to differences in the amount and fat percentage of the ground beef used in the filling, as well as the overall patty size. How many calories in a 7 11 Jamaican beef patty?

4 min read
According to nutritional data from 7-Eleven Canada, one Jamaican Beef Patty contains approximately 300 calories.
